    Can you also default all the Nvidia Control Panel graphic settings?
    If the in-game settings conflict with Nvidia's then it can also cause this.
    Just default and don't change anything then try.

    After if that doesn;t help, try switching to "Fullscreen Windowed" mode in-game and see if FPS increases to where you want it to be.
    If it does then mind the game's EXE and right click > properties > disable full screen optimizations

    I also have the same laptop and I think I know what the problem might be. When I play R6S, the game switches to the integrated GPU instead of the dedicated one, even though I configured it to use the high-performance NVIDIA processor in the NVIDIA control panel. I had to manually change it in the game files. Try running the task manager while playing to see what GPU you are using.

    Hi together, I bought this Notebook 2 and had nearly the same issues. I couldnt Play Warzone with more than 50-70 Frames on the lowest Settings but on YouTube you can clearly see, that you can easily play with 100 Frames plus (RTX 2060 mobile). I found out that my 2133mhz 16 gb single channel Ram was the Problem. I upgraded to 2x8 gb 2666mhz and that did the trick. I got 100+ Frames when playing warzone and that with higher Settings than before. Maybe that is what is bottlenecking your Performance k4waii.     I have this exact same problem. A few months ago, games used to run perfect. Warzone all high was easily 95+ average. Now it struggles to maintain 55 in all low. Doesnt make a difference if i turn on DXR with all high, the fps is still 55ish. i tried dropping down resolution with no effect on fps. There is no cap on fps set by me.
    I have a triton 500, rtx 2060, 8750h, dual channel 16gb, bios v1.12

    Here is what i've tried so far:
    -warzone reinstall
    -geforce experience uninstall, reinstall, nvidia control panel uninstall, reinstall
    -windows reinstall, keeping files, removing all files, i even installed a windows 10 manually from a usb stick
    -install all the "performance upgrade" updates in the acer website
    -tweaked all the settings in nvidia control panel (high performance, prefer performance over quality etc)
    -windows game bar stuff disabled
    -tried undervolting
    -turbo mode doesnt help
    -tried changing thermal paste, it has resulted to better thermal performance, like the laptop cools down faster now, but no impact on gaming

    usual temps even after this poor performance is : gpu 86C avg, cpu 90C avg

    Please let me know if there is anything i can try. I have tried everything in this thread with the exception of downgrading the bios to 1.02, as i dont know how to do it. And i doubt it will help, but if anyone is certain that it will, pls leave a link to how to get that bios.
